Native Plant Planting Schemes

Support local biodiversity by incorporating pollinator-friendly flora into your garden design. These sustainable plants thrive in Sammamish’s climate and minimize the need for fertilizers, pesticides, and excess watering. Landscape designers integrate them into mixed borders for both beauty and ecological benefit.

  • Incorporate salal, red flowering currant, Oregon grape, and other indigenous species
  • Build a bioswale to manage runoff
  • Mix native plants with shade structures for maximum efficiency
  • Consult with a certified arborist for tree preservation and canopy integration

Canopy Preservation Rules

Trimming trees in Sammamish often requires a arborist report, especially for protected specimens. A tree care specialist can assess whether a tree qualifies for removal or needs preservation under Sammamish Parks and Rec ordinances. Ignoring these rules risks legal action.

  • Apply for a arborist waiver before any work begins
  • Include a site map showing trunk diameter during permit application
  • Preserve valuable trees by integrating them into your patio design

Snow-Tolerant Landscaping

Using frost-resistant plants is essential for lasting curb appeal in Sammamish’s climate. A plant specialist recommends hardy groundcovers that thrive in wet soil and chilly temps. These species reduce the need for heavy irrigation.

Blend plants like Oregon grape, redtwig dogwood, or sedges into your front yard design. They provide structure while supporting sustainable landscaping.

Watering Schedule Optimization

Adjusting your drip timing prevents waste and keeps plants thriving. A design pro sets seasonal zones based on plant needs. In Sammamish, this often means shutting off systems in winter and activating in summer dry spells.

  • Use a Wi-Fi irrigation for efficient watering
  • Divide your drip lines by plant type
  • Check lines and heads seasonally

Landscape Budget Planning

Average Design Project Costs

Comparing the expected costs for a outdoor layout helps you plan wisely. In Sammamish, most homeowners spend between $3,000–$12,000 for a full 3D design rendering from a landscape architecture firm. This includes lighting concepts.

  • Design-only fees range from $1,500–$5,000 depending on yard size
  • Turnkey projects average $15,000–$50,000+ with hardscapes and softscapes
  • Fire pit installation add $5,000–$20,000 depending on materials
